As you venture out from your hotel, the Old Town, a UNESCO World Heritage site, is a must-visit destination. This area, meticulously reconstructed after World War II, showcases colorful buildings and cobblestone streets that transport visitors back in time. While wandering through the Old Town, be sure to stop at the Royal Castle, which served as the official residence of Polish monarchs. The castle’s opulent interiors and rich history provide a fascinating glimpse into Poland’s royal past. Furthermore, the nearby Market Square, with its lively atmosphere and numerous cafes, is perfect for enjoying a traditional Polish meal or a cup of coffee while soaking in the local ambiance.

Transitioning from the historical to the contemporary, the Warsaw Uprising Museum offers a poignant insight into the city’s tumultuous past during World War II. This museum is dedicated to the Warsaw Uprising of 1944 and features interactive exhibits, photographs, and personal stories that bring the events to life. Visiting this museum not only deepens your understanding of Warsaw’s history but also highlights the resilience of its people. For those seeking a unique dining experience, the Hala Koszyki food hall is an excellent choice. This vibrant venue combines a variety of culinary offerings, from traditional Polish dishes to international cuisine, all under one roof. The lively atmosphere, complete with local vendors and artisanal products, makes it a perfect spot for food enthusiasts. As you savor the diverse flavors, you can also engage with local chefs and learn about the ingredients that define Polish cuisine.

As your exploration continues, a visit to Łazienki Park is essential for those who appreciate nature and tranquility. This expansive park is home to beautiful gardens, historic palaces, and the famous Chopin Monument, dedicated to the renowned composer. The park’s serene environment provides a perfect escape from the bustling city, allowing visitors to relax and enjoy leisurely walks amidst lush greenery. During the summer months, free outdoor concerts featuring Chopin’s music are held, attracting both locals and tourists alike.
